"Father Ted" creator Graham Linehan cleared as U.K. police drop investigation into his social media posts that drew international criticism and free speech concerns.
Father Ted creator Graham Linehan was in the clear last night after Scotland Yard dropped an investigation into his online comments about transgender activists. His victory came as the Metropolitan Police in Greater London announced they will no longer investigate such ‘non-crime hate incidents’ (NCHIs).
London’s Metropolitan Police confirmed they are investigating allegations that Prince Andrew asked one of its officers to dig up dirt about his sexual abuse accuser, Virginia Giuffre. The prince — who was forced to give up his royal title as Duke of York on Friday in a humiliating fall from grace — reportedly emailed his late mother Queen Elizabeth II’s deputy press secretary in 2011 and said he gave an officer Giuffre’s personal information,
Britain's Prince Andrew asked police in 2011 to dig up personal information about Virginia Giuffre, the woman who accused him of sexually abusing her as a teenager, a British newspaper reported on Sunday,
